Jets™ 25MBA Vacuumarator™ pump
Tel. +47 70 03 91 00
www.jetsgroup.com
Product No. 200025004
Doc. Rev.: 22 (2021-06-08)
1
Vacuumarator™ pumps are the most compact efficient and reliable
vacuum generators available for vacuum sanitary systems. The
pump creates vacuum, macerates sewage and discharges in one
single pass operation.
Features:
Highly efficient in transporting wastewater
Small footprint and low weight allows for quick and flexible
installation
In line installation - direct discharge to sewer, STP (Sewage
Treatment Plant) or collecting tank
Multiphase design - pumps any combination of air, black and
grey water
Low energy consumption
High quality – low lifecycle cost
Technical Data
...................................
Capacity 26 m³/h (ACMH) at 500 mbar abs. 60 Hz
(50% Vacuum)
......................................................................
Back Pressure Max. 0.3 bar
..................................
Outside Dimensions 702 x 198 x 278 mm (LxWxH)
..............................................................................
Connection Inlet DN50
...........................................................................
Connection Outlet DN32
...............................................................................
Protection Class IP 55
..............................................................
Insulation Class 155(F) to 130(B)
...........................................................................................
Duty S1-100%
.............................................
Ambient Temperature Range +0 °C - 55 °C
Humidity Class F / 95%
..............................................................
Approvals Motor - CSA Approved
..................................................................................
Net Weight 66.50 kg
Operating Data
....................................................................................
Frequency // 60 Hz
................................................................................
Voltage // Δ198-218 V
.........................................................................
Nominal Current // 12.9 A
...........................................................................
Speed CCW // 3435 rpm
...........................................................................
Power Output // 3.45 kW
.......................................................................
Power Factor // 0.88 cos ɸ
.....................................................................................
Efficiency // 84.5%
...............................................................
Heat Dissipation Approx. 0.6 kW
